Over the years, product management has attempted many different approaches for describing customer needs. We've used traditional requirements, use cases and have tried open discussions. Today, we often use some form of story. Most teams have adopted a user story formula for writing requirements: “As a <role>, I want <a feature> so I can <achieve an outcome> ” Structure is nice.
